Water pressure repair services address issues related to inconsistent or insufficient water flow within a plumbing system. These services typically involve diagnosing the root cause of water pressure problems, which can stem from issues such as clogged pipes, faulty pressure regulators, or leaks. Once the problem is identified, technicians can perform repairs or replacements to restore proper water flow. The goal is to ensure that homes and businesses experience steady, reliable water pressure for daily needs like bathing, cooking, and cleaning.
Problems solved through water pressure repair include low water flow, sudden drops in pressure, or fluctuating water volume that can disrupt routine activities. In some cases, high water pressure may cause damage to plumbing fixtures or lead to leaks, requiring adjustments or repairs to prevent further issues. Addressing these problems can help prolong the lifespan of pipes and fixtures, reduce water wastage, and improve overall water system performance. Properly functioning water pressure also helps prevent damage caused by pressure surges or leaks that can lead to costly repairs if left unaddressed.

The overview below groups typical Water Pressure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Monroe, WA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Service Call Fees - Typical costs for diagnosing water pressure issues range from $75 to $200, depending on the complexity of the problem. An example service might be a $100 fee for an initial assessment by a local professional.
Repair Costs - Repairing water pressure problems can cost between $150 and $500, influenced by the extent of the repairs needed. For instance, replacing a faulty pressure regulator may cost around $250 to $400.
Part Replacement Expenses - Replacing specific components such as pressure regulators or valves generally costs between $50 and $200. The price varies based on the part's type and the local provider's rates.
Whole-System Repairs - Extensive repairs or system overhauls may range from $500 to $2,000, depending on the size of the property and the severity of the pressure issues.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on the specific situation.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
